From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Peter Dyballa Newsgroups: gmane.emacs.bugs Subject: bug#11172: 24.0.95; mini-buffer contents is overwritten by output in echo-area Date: Wed, 4 Apr 2012 18:24:09 +0200 Message-ID: <167E656F-B2FD-46FE-9026-C21EE3581EFB@Freenet.DE>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 (Apple Message framework v1084) Content-Type: text/plain; charset=windows-1252 Content-Transfer-Encoding: quoted-printable X-Trace: dough.gmane.org 1333556879 31274 80.91.229.3 (4 Apr 2012 16:27:59 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Wed, 4 Apr 2012 16:27:59 +0000 (UTC) To: 11172@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Wed Apr 04 18:27:58 2012 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1SFT3t-0006aq-1K for geb-bug-gnu-emacs@m.gmane.org; Wed, 04 Apr 2012 18:27:57 +0200 Original-Received: from localhost ([::1]:36894 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1SFT3i-0006w0-7I for geb-bug-gnu-emacs@m.gmane.org; Wed, 04 Apr 2012 12:27:46 -0400 Original-Received: from eggs.gnu.org ([208.118.235.92]:47589)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1SFT3e-0006vm-UI for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 12:27:44 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1SFT3Y-00037Z-Mu for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 12:27:42 -0400 Original-Received: from debbugs.gnu.org ([140.186.70.43]:43595)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1SFT3Y-00037L-Ir for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 12:27:36 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.72) (envelope-from ) id 1SFT3y-0006Lq-0s for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 12:28: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Peter Dyballa Original-Sender: debbugs-submit-bounces@debbugs.gnu.org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Wed, 04 Apr 2012 16:28: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 11172 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: X-Debbugs-Original-To: bug-gnu-emacs@gnu.org Original-Received: via spool by submit@debbugs.gnu.org id=B.133355686024384 (code B ref -1); Wed, 04 Apr 2012 16:28:01 +0000 Original-Received: (at submit) by debbugs.gnu.org; 4 Apr 2012 16:27:40 +0000 Original-Received: from localhost ([127.0.0.1]:40133 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1SFT3b-0006LE-9U for submit@debbugs.gnu.org; Wed, 04 Apr 2012 12:27:40 -0400 Original-Received: from eggs.gnu.org ([208.118.235.92]:35104)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1SFT3X-0006Ku-AT for submit@debbugs.gnu.org; Wed, 04 Apr 2012 12:27:37 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1SFT2z-0002u1-0k for submit@debbugs.gnu.org; Wed, 04 Apr 2012 12:27:07 -0400 Original-Received: from lists.gnu.org ([208.118.235.17]:60714)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1SFT2y-0002tv-Tb for submit@debbugs.gnu.org; Wed, 04 Apr 2012 12:27:00 -0400 Original-Received: from eggs.gnu.org ([208.118.235.92]:47454)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1SFT2u-0006qw-2J for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 12:27:00 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1SFT2o-0002sn-UP for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 12:26:55 -0400 Original-Received: from mout6.freenet.de ([195.4.92.96]:53777)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1SFT2o-0002sT-Nh for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 12:26:50 -0400 Original-Received: from [195.4.92.140] (helo=mjail0.freenet.de) by mout6.freenet.de with esmtpa (ID peter_dyballa@freenet.de) (port 25) (Exim 4.76 #1) id 1SFT2m-00083J-F4 for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 18:26:48 +0200 Original-Received: from localhost ([::1]:47265 helo=mjail0.freenet.de) by mjail0.freenet.de with esmtpa (ID peter_dyballa@freenet.de) (Exim 4.76 #1) id 1SFT2m-0001sJ-B1 for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 18:26:48 +0200 Original-Received: from [195.4.92.25] (port=53169 helo=15.mx.freenet.de) by mjail0.freenet.de with esmtpa (ID peter_dyballa@freenet.de) (Exim 4.76 #1) id 1SFT0E-00012Q-Tz for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 18:24:10 +0200 Original-Received: from ip-88-153-242-186.unitymediagroup.de ([88.153.242.186]:52728 helo=sumac.fritz.box) by 15.mx.freenet.de with esmtpsa (ID peter_dyballa@freenet.de) (TLSv1:AES128-SHA:128) (port 587) (Exim 4.76 #1) id 1SFT0E-0006tM-3q for bug-gnu-emacs@gnu.org; Wed, 04 Apr 2012 18:24:10 +0200 X-Mailer: Apple Mail (2.1084) X-detected-operating-system: by eggs.gnu.org: Genre and OS details not recognized. X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 3) X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.13 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 2) X-Received-From: 140.186.70.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:58514 Archived-At: Hello! Here is a simple case, which also shows more than just an annoyance. Launch just compiled GNU Emacs with -Q, execute in *scratch* buffer (add-hook 'dired-mode-hook 'auto-revert-mode)=20 and open the recent buffer in dired. Just for fun type M-x compile RET and add some (meaningless) text to the make command or overwrite it with = ./configure . Now contemplate a bit, do as if trying to invoke = configure in the other shell, from which GNU Emacs 24.0.95 was launched, = to get its options. But type instead touch something Still wait a moment, look at the text in the mini-buffer =96 oh, it's = gone! It might be substituted with something like Reverting buffer `emacs-24.0.94'. And when you now go to the Help menu to check "Send Bug Report..." no = "*unsent Mail ..." buffer will open but the text apply: Command attempted to use minibuffer while in minibuffer will appear in mini-buffer/echo-area. This can happen quite often, also when contemplating over a regexp, or = find-grep, or whatever. It might be often easy to get back to the = original state, by some cursor backward or forward movement, but it is = annoying. IMO it's cleaner when GNU Emacs would wait a while before = spitting out some message until I have finished editing in mini-buffer. In GNU Emacs 24.0.95.1 (x86_64-apple-darwin10.8.0, X toolkit, Xaw3d = scroll bars) of 2012-04-04 on sumac.fritz.box Windowing system distributor `The X.Org Foundation', version = 11.0.11200000 Configured using: `configure '--without-sound' '--without-dbus' '--without-pop' '--without-gconf' '--without-gpm' '--with-x-toolkit=3Dathena' '--without-xpm' '--without-jpeg' '--without-tiff' '--without-gif' '--without-png' '--without-rsvg' '--enable-locallisppath=3D/Library/Application Support/Emacs/calendar24:/Library/Application Support/Emacs' 'CFLAGS=3D-v= -g -H -pipe -fPIC -fno-common -march=3Dcore2 -mtune=3Dcore2 -m64 -fast -fomit-frame-pointer -msse4.2 -foptimize-register-move -ftree-vectorize -fnested-functions' 'LDFLAGS=3D-Wl,-dead_strip_dylibs -Wl,-bind_at_load -Wl,-t' = 'PKG_CONFIG_PATH=3D/opt/local/lib/pkgconfig:/opt/local/share/pkgconfig:/us= r/lib/pkgconfig'' Important settings: value of $LC_ALL: nil value of $LC_COLLATE: nil value of $LC_CTYPE: de_DE.UTF-8 value of $LC_MESSAGES: nil value of $LC_MONETARY: nil value of $LC_NUMERIC: nil value of $LC_TIME: nil value of $LANG: de_DE.UTF-8 value of $XMODIFIERS: nil locale-coding-system: utf-8-unix default enable-multibyte-characters: t Major mode: Dired by name Minor modes in effect: shell-dirtrack-mode: t text-scale-mode: t auto-revert-mode: t tooltip-mode: t mouse-wheel-mode: t tool-bar-mode: t menu-bar-mode: t file-name-shadow-mode: t global-font-lock-mode: t font-lock-mode: t blink-cursor-mode: t auto-composition-mode: t auto-encryption-mode: t auto-compression-mode: t line-number-mode: t transient-mark-mode: t Recent input: C-j=20 C-x d =20 M-x c o m p i l e b d s c l n=20 S =20 =20 =20 =20 =20 Recent messages: For information about GNU Emacs and the GNU system, type C-h C-a. Mark set ls does not support --dired; see `dired-use-ls-dired' for more details. Reverting buffer `emacs-24.0.94'. apply: Command attempted to use minibuffer while in minibuffer -- Greetings Pete The future will be much better tomorrow. =96 George W. Bush